How they compare
Kyrgyzstan currently reports 49,540 t against 42,392 t in Ecuador, a difference of 7,148 t.
That makes Kyrgyzstan's figure about 1.2 times Ecuador's.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Kyrgyzstan ahead.
Ecuador ranks 47th and Kyrgyzstan ranks 44th of 185 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Ecuador averaged higher in 3 and Kyrgyzstan in 1.

About this data
The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
